Formation of mineral nanoparticles inside of the hydrogel matrix was proved by X-ray diffraction analysis, optical spectroscopy, and Energy-dispersive X-ray spectroscopy. It was shown that the nature of polymer matrix has an essential effect on the formation of crystal phase when synthesizing the mineral nanoparticle inside of hydrogels. The rate of the CdS nanoparticle formation depended on the nature of the hydrogel matrix: in anionic matrices it was higher than in cationic ones, while the Cd/S ratio depended on the crosslinking density of the polymer net. In the presence of starch in the hydrogel matrix, the crystal phase of calcium phosphates did not form. The hydrogel nanocomposites obtained are highly elastic materials. A possible application of the hydrogel nanocomposites obtained is discussed.
